Impact of Sunlight Intensity



Occasionally, the strength of sunlight can considerably affect the performance of solar panels. When the sunlight is solid and straight, your solar panels generate even more electricity. Nevertheless, during cloudy days or when the sun is at a low angle, the panels obtain less sunlight, lowering their efficiency. To optimize the energy result of your photovoltaic panels, it's essential to install them in locations with ample sunlight direct exposure throughout the day. Consider variables like shading from close-by trees or buildings that can block sunlight and decrease the panels' performance.

To maximize the performance of your solar panels, on a regular basis clean them to eliminate any kind of dust, dirt, or particles that may be obstructing sunshine absorption. In addition, ensure that your panels are angled properly to receive the most direct sunshine possible.

Role of Cloud Cover and Rain



Cloud cover and rainfall can dramatically affect the performance of photovoltaic panels. When clouds block the sunlight, the quantity of sunlight reaching your photovoltaic panels is minimized, leading to a decline in power manufacturing. Rain can also affect photovoltaic panel effectiveness by obstructing sunshine and developing a layer of dirt or gunk on the panels, additionally lowering their ability to generate power. Even light rain can scatter sunshine, triggering it to be less concentrated on the panels.



Throughout cloudy days with hefty cloud cover, solar panels might experience a considerable drop in energy outcome. However, it deserves noting that some contemporary photovoltaic panel modern technologies can still produce electrical energy also when the sky is gloomy. Furthermore, rain can have a cleaning effect on solar panels, washing away dust and dust that may have built up over time.

To make best use of the effectiveness of your solar panels, it's necessary to think about the impact of cloud cover and rains on energy manufacturing and ensure that your panels are effectively kept to withstand differing weather conditions.
